It all started with an Alien

An unusual exposition was founded by good friends Andrei, Artem and Vladislav. Since childhood, they loved fantastic Hollywood films and, one might say, grew up on famous stories about Aliens and Predators. Perhaps this is why the Alien became the first figure with whom the unusual museum of the uprising of cars in Pargolovo actually began.

The founders of the institution had creative friends and acquaintances who helped to bring the idea to life. Retro cars were restored, motorcycle helmets were painted, and figures for the main exhibition were collected from … scrap metal.

Then the simple, but very passionate about the idea guys were not afraid and put all their savings into organizing and arranging an extraordinary exhibition. Of course, they would like to return their funds, but fears that such an exhibition would be of interest only to children from the neighborhood and, possibly, their parents, still remained.

Museum of the rebellion of cars in Pargolovo today

Today, the exhibition is popular not only with residents of St. Petersburg, but also with guests who come even from other countries.

What can you see in the museum?

An exposition of several figures awaits the visitor already at the entrance. Sometimes they change their location: some move inside the museum, others become "on guard" outside. Such changes are usually associated with new exhibitions or even the dimensions of the figures. Agree, the six-meter Optimus Prime is not so easy to hide under the roof.

Near the entrance, visitors are greeted by retrocars and the figure of the Ghost Rider. Next to the Racer is an impressive collection of painted helmets.

Image

Next, guests enter the Marvel Hall, which gathered the favorite characters of comics and films. Here is the good robot Valley, Bender and, of course, famous superheroes. The next room - real biomechanical jungle with dinosaurs, birds, bulls, elephants and horses. A separate room is occupied by Transformers, and another large room is divided in the eternal confrontation between Predators and Aliens. Fans of films about the Terminator Arnold Schwarzenegger here, of course, will not see. But frightening machines, parts of their bodies and heads with eyes predatory glowing red, are present here.

It is interesting that the whole interior here is decorated as part of a common theme. Only the Pogolovo Museum of Machine Rise boasts coffee tables in the form of Spider-Man, made in the style of biomechanics, lamps with dragon heads and mechanical sunflowers in front of the entrance.

Only exposure? Or something else?

If you could only admire the figures from the exhibition, albeit so unusual, then this museum would be quite ordinary. But this is not so.

The museum can be rented for a children's holiday, here you can learn to play the laser harp and get acquainted with the living Predator. If you wish, you can even learn to drive a real tank, because a special training ground with absolute copies of Soviet and German cars is opened in front of the museum.

In addition, not a single holiday is missed here. For example, on Valentine's Day, all couples who came were invited to try the cocktail of love prepared by the aliens and leave their message to future generations of earthlings.

It is also pleasing that the museum's exposition is constantly replenished. Now, for example, work is underway to create the real Transformer. It will be in front of an amazed audience to gather from the car into a robot. It is planned that Bumblebee will move permanently to the Museum of the Rise of the Cars in Pargolovo. When the new exposition opens, unfortunately, is still unknown. One thing is certain: it’s technically possible to recreate such a Transformer.

How to get here?

From Finland Station you need to get to the museum by train. It will take about 20 minutes to go all this way. You can also come by minibus, then from the metro station "Prospekt Prosvescheniya" the road will take 15 minutes. You can get to the village by car.

What else do you need to know for those who want to get into the museum of the uprising of cars in Pargolovo? Exposure mode. Every day the doors of the museum are open to visitors from 12 to 23 hours.
